Derrick Rose’s future with the Cleveland Cavaliers may be in jeopardy as ESPN’s Adrian Wojnarowski dropped a bomb on Friday afternoon.
According to the NBA insider, Rose is currently away from the team and evaluating his future in basketball as he is “tired of being hurt.”
Rose has already missed 11 of the Cavs’ 18 games this season due to a lingering ankle injury and hasn’t played more than 66 games since the 2010-11 campaign.
The point guard’s loss would be a big hit to a Cavs team that currently has just one point guard available, third stringer Jose Calderon.
